The Impact of Voice Search on Digital Marketing Strategies

Voice search has transformed the landscape of digital marketing, influencing how businesses connect with their audiences. With the rise of smart speakers and voice-activated devices, understanding this shift is crucial for modern marketing strategies.

Voice search allows users to perform searches on the internet using spoken commands instead of typing. Technologies like Siri, Alexa, Google Assistant, and Cortana have popularized this method, making it a common way for consumers to find information quickly and conveniently.

How Voice Search Impacts Digital Marketing

Businesses must adapt their marketing strategies to optimize for voice search. Unlike traditional text-based searches, voice queries tend to be more conversational and longer. This shift affects keyword research, content creation, and SEO practices.

Changes in Keyword Optimization

Marketers should focus on long-tail keywords and natural language phrases that reflect how people speak. For example, instead of “best pizza NYC,” a voice search might be “Where can I find the best pizza in New York City?”

Content Strategy Adjustments

Content should be structured to answer common questions clearly and concisely. Using FAQ sections and conversational language helps improve visibility in voice search results.

Opportunities for Businesses

Voice search offers new opportunities to reach customers. Local businesses, in particular, can benefit by optimizing for “near me” searches and ensuring their information is accurate on platforms like Google My Business.

Challenges to Consider

Adapting to voice search requires ongoing effort. It involves updating SEO strategies, creating relevant content, and understanding evolving user behaviors. Additionally, privacy concerns and data security are important considerations for businesses leveraging voice technology.

Conclusion

Voice search is reshaping digital marketing by emphasizing natural language, local SEO, and user intent. Businesses that adapt early can gain a competitive edge, providing more accessible and engaging experiences for their customers in this new era of search technology.
